WebUnix/Linux You can run MALIN from the command line, launching java -jar Malin.jar. You will probably need to enable larger memory usage for the JVM than the default setting, which you can do by launching MALIN as java -Xmx1024M -jar Malin.jar. WebMobile group II introns, found in bacterial and organellar genomes, are both catalytic RNAs and retrotransposable elements. They use an extraordinary mobility mechanism in which the excised intron RNA reverse splices directly into a DNA target site and is then reverse transcribed by the intron-encod …
